Who was Walter T. Kerwin, Jr.?
Walter Thomas Kerwin, Jr. was a United States Army four star general who served as Commanding General, U.S. Continental Army Command, 1973; Commanding General, United States Army Forces Command from 1973 to 1974; and Vice Chief of Staff, U.S. Army from 1974 to 1978. He was the first commander of United States Army Forces Command and a member of the Association of the United States Army’s Advisory Board of Directors since 1984.
